Job Title: Database Administrator 4 (DBA4)
Job Description: Work will be performed Offsite to start with Offsite and /or Onsite based on COVID-19 Pandemic circumstances. Hybrid application development/database administration position. 7 years of experience. SQL Server. Primary focus will be on SQL development with some SQL operations activity.

Preferred Experience:
• Application Development
o Agile project team member
o Translation of business requirements to application database design
o Create and revise logical and physical databased design documentation
o Development of complex stored procedures for application data access
o Analysis and execution of data migrations from legacy applications
o Data warehouse/reporting solutions design
o Contribution to continuous process improvement
o Database deployment using Visual Studio SQL Server Data Tools
o git source control

• Database Administration
o SQL Server installation, configuration, version upgrades, patching
o Capacity planning
o Performance monitoring/tuning
o Data security – HIPAA compliance, user administration, encryption, masking, auditing
o Records retention/archival policy
o Business continuity/disaster recovery strategy
o Contribution to DBA team standards and best practices

• Environment
o SQL Server (REQUIRED)
o SSIS/SSRS (REQUIRED)
o Visual Studio (REQUIRED)
o TFS (REQUIRED)
o Powershell and GIT (REQUIRED)
o Microsoft Office
o Bonus Integrations and Reporting Experience: .NET; PowerShell; AZURE SQL, AD; COGNOS, Crystal, Tableau, PowerBI, IMS, DB2 and Cache (nice to have)
